They are magnesium sand-cast Campagnolos, of the same design used on the Lancia Stratos Group 4 Rally cars of the same era. Some people have taken to referring to them as 'coffin-spoke' wheels in obvious reference to the design of their spokes.

Very nice Marcello, and thanks again for sharing. Yes, GTO 8 Y does have French history as evidenced by its yellow driving lamps, and in fact it is the ex-Jean-Jacques Setton GTO, formerly registered 637 RL 78 in France.
